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9918 884 13020668602 61246100765
70745 879013777
70745 879013777
266864516 53805780 92763
All about undefined
Interested in learning more?
70745 879013777
266864516 53805780 92763
See more
91895617 85783 4250
68271 6702859 41749 804
See more
26 35 296
46411238 931249 2597070669 05231697
See more